Black Stories Collective/Voices of Iowa: Willie Mae Wright

Gwenne Berry and the Grout Museum's Pat Kinney recently interviewed Willie Mae Wright for the Black Stories Collective/Voices of Iowa oral history archive.
In this segment, Willie Mae talks about her Grandmother, who was sold in to slavery as a child, the importance of registering to and exercising your right to vote, and the positivity and togetherness of recent Juneteenth celebrations in Waterloo.
